Medical Laboratory Science is the study of laboratory techniques, procedures, and equipment used to analyze patient samples and support clinical diagnosis and treatment. Students in Worcester who pursue this field learn about hematology, microbiology, clinical chemistry, and immunology—skills that prepare them for careers as laboratory technicians or technologists in hospitals, diagnostic labs, and research facilities. It's a hands-on subject that combines biology, chemistry, and practical lab skills.
